/** * {@inheritDoc} */ @Override public synchronized ValidatesModel addValidate(ValidateModel validate) { addChildModel(validate); _validates.add(validate); return this; }
/** * {@inheritDoc} */ @Override public SwitchYardModel getSwitchYard() { return (SwitchYardModel)getModelParent(); }
/** * Constructs a new V1ValidatesModel with the specified Configuration and Descriptor. * @param config the Configuration * @param desc the Descriptor */ public V1ValidatesModel(Configuration config, Descriptor desc) { super(config, desc); for (Configuration validate_config : config.getChildrenStartsWith(ValidateModel.VALIDATE)) { ValidateModel validate = (ValidateModel)readModel(validate_config); if (validate != null) { _validates.add(validate); } } setModelChildrenOrder(ValidateModel.VALIDATE); }
return new V1TransformsModel(config, desc); } else if (name.equals(ValidatesModel.VALIDATES)) { return new V1ValidatesModel(config, desc); } else if (name.equals(ArtifactsModel.ARTIFACTS)) { return new V1ArtifactsModel(config, desc);
/** * Constructs a new V1ValidatesModel. * @param namespace namespace */ public V1ValidatesModel(String namespace) { super(new QName(namespace, ValidatesModel.VALIDATES)); setModelChildrenOrder(ValidateModel.VALIDATE); }
return new V1TransformsModel(config, desc); } else if (name.equals(ValidatesModel.VALIDATES)) { return new V1ValidatesModel(config, desc); } else if (name.equals(ArtifactsModel.ARTIFACTS)) { return new V1ArtifactsModel(config, desc);
/** * Constructs a new V1ValidatesModel. * @param namespace namespace */ public V1ValidatesModel(String namespace) { super(new QName(namespace, ValidatesModel.VALIDATES)); setModelChildrenOrder(ValidateModel.VALIDATE); }
validatesModel = new V1ValidatesModel(switchyardNamespace.uri()); switchyardModel.setValidates(validatesModel);
/** * Constructs a new V1ValidatesModel with the specified Configuration and Descriptor. * @param config the Configuration * @param desc the Descriptor */ public V1ValidatesModel(Configuration config, Descriptor desc) { super(config, desc); for (Configuration validate_config : config.getChildrenStartsWith(ValidateModel.VALIDATE)) { ValidateModel validate = (ValidateModel)readModel(validate_config); if (validate != null) { _validates.add(validate); } } setModelChildrenOrder(ValidateModel.VALIDATE); }
/** * {@inheritDoc} */ @Override public SwitchYardModel getSwitchYard() { return (SwitchYardModel)getModelParent(); }
/** * {@inheritDoc} */ @Override public synchronized ValidatesModel addValidate(ValidateModel validate) { addChildModel(validate); _validates.add(validate); return this; }
validatesModel = new V1ValidatesModel(switchyardNamespace.uri()); switchyardModel.setValidates(validatesModel);
if (switchYardConfig.getValidates() == null) { String switchYardNamespace = getSwitchYardNamespace(switchYardConfig); switchYardConfig.setValidates(new V1ValidatesModel(switchYardNamespace));